JO-8 nesting tablesJO-8 nesting tables are a homage to Josf Albers nesting tables, designed at the Bauhaus in 1927. Designer: Timothy Schreiber (United Kingdom)
X LOUNGER by Timothy Schreiberoriginally designed as a proposed outdoor lounge chair for Toyo Ito's Serpentine Pavillion, the geometry of Timothy Schreiber's X_LOUNGER is based on a single ray, traced along a periodic double curved surface. However, with the start of the Beijing Olympics and the media focus on the games' main stadium, it will most likely be nicknamed "the bird's nest chair" shortly. Designer: Timothy Schreiber (United Kingdom)
Zero G TableZERO G TABLE is made from carbon nano tubes, a technology originally developed for tennis racquets. Carbon nanotubes are 10 times stiffer than conventional graphite and are extremely durable. They also weigh just a fraction of conventional materials. The sopisticated mechanism at the legs, allows them to be dismantled without any tools yet the table appears to be formed from one continuous piece of stretched material. Designer: Timothy Schreiber (United Kingdom)
Universal table generatorUniversal table generator is based on self-similar, modular geometry and organic growth algorithms. The user can easily generate highly complex table structures simply by specifying functional constraints such as overall desired shape. The program generates a structure from a family of varied modular branches that are economically fabricated by conventional methods, yet combine to allow an endless variety of permutations within the given constraints.
